π‘οΈ Before You Head Away or Settle In
To avoid preventable issues (which may be chargeable if caused by neglect), please take a moment to check the following:
- Test smoke detectors and carbon monoxide alarms
- Leave your thermostat on a low, consistent temperature to help prevent damp, mould, and frozen pipes
- Check your boiler pressure and thermostat batteries
- Bleed radiators if needed
- Avoid overloading plug sockets
- Never leave candles unattended or near Christmas trees/greenery
- Consider using battery-operated candles
- Switch off/unplug fairy lights at night or when going out
- Inspect Christmas lights for any damage before using them
